What this means in plain terms
When a business needs to run servers, store data, or host applications, it has two basic choices: build and run its own server room, or place that equipment inside a purpose-built facility run by a specialist. The second option — colocation — is almost always safer and cheaper once a business grows past a small scale, because a purpose-built data centre has redundant power, cooling, physical security, and trained staff on-site around the clock.

Greenfield SDN & the Cisco ACI Fabric
A traditional data centre network is built up over years, with switches and cabling added piecemeal as needs change — leaving inconsistent performance and a network that's hard to reconfigure. Hispar's facility was instead built as a "greenfield" deployment: designed and constructed from a blank slate around a single, modern architecture from day one.
That architecture is Software-Defined Networking (SDN) on a 100 gigabit-per-second Cisco ACI fabric — meaning the network's behaviour is controlled centrally through software policy rather than manually configured, switch by switch.
- Micro-segmentation of client & application traffic
- Automated, consistent policy enforcement
- Elimination of legacy, piecemeal network bottlenecks
Colocation and Space Options
Flexible configurations scaling from a single rack unit to fully dedicated private data halls.
Colocation (Colo)
Shared data-hall space with dedicated cabinet or rack allocation, suited to small and mid-sized deployments.
Dedicated Rack or Cage
A fully enclosed, client-exclusive rack or cage for organisations with stricter physical-security or compliance requirements.
Dedicated Data-Hall Space
An entire private data hall for the largest enterprise and government deployments.
Cross-Connects
Direct physical or logical connections between a client's equipment and another tenant, carrier, or cloud provider — avoiding the latency and cost of routing traffic outside the building.
Power-as-a-Service
Power delivery billed and managed as a service rather than a fixed capital installation, allowing capacity to scale with demand.
Remote Hands & Smarts
On-site Hispar engineers who can perform physical tasks — reboots, cabling, hardware swaps — on a client's behalf, without needing staff physically present in Lahore.

Disaster Recovery Footprint
Hispar's disaster recovery (DR) strategy spans three cities. The primary data centre and headquarters sit in Lahore, with metro-area DR capability available within the same city for the fastest possible failover, and dedicated DR sites in Karachi and Islamabad providing geographic separation in the event of a regional outage.
Every cloud and data centre tenant operates under RTO/RPO-defined SLAs — meaning the maximum acceptable time to restore service (RTO) and the maximum acceptable amount of data loss measured in time (RPO) are explicitly agreed and contracted, not left as a vague promise.
